Description

The Sigma Standard Series SDR-28 is a remarkable example of quality craftsmanship in the world of steel-string acoustic guitars. Known for its rich tonal quality, this guitar is a favorite among both seasoned musicians and those new to the acoustic scene. The SDR-28 features a solid Sitka spruce top, which is prized for its ability to deliver clear and powerful sound projection. Paired with rosewood back and sides, the guitar provides a balanced and warm tonal range, making it versatile for various music styles.

Sigma's attention to detail is evident in the SDR-28's construction and aesthetics. The dovetail neck joint ensures stability and resonance, while the mahogany neck offers a comfortable grip and smooth playability. Aesthetically, the guitar boasts a classic look with its tortoise pickguard and elegant binding, appealing to players who appreciate timeless design.

The SDR-28 is equipped with a bone nut and saddle, enhancing its tonal clarity and sustain. Additionally, the Grover die-cast tuners provide reliable tuning stability, ensuring your performance remains uninterrupted. This guitar is an ideal choice for those seeking an instrument that seamlessly blends traditional design with modern playability.

FAQs

What is the body shape of the Sigma Standard Series SDR-28?

The Sigma Standard Series SDR-28 features a dreadnought body shape, which is known for its large size and powerful, resonant sound, making it ideal for a wide range of musical styles.

What materials are used in the construction of the Sigma SDR-28?

The Sigma SDR-28 is constructed with a spruce top and rosewood back and sides, offering a balanced tone with rich lows and clear highs, while the mahogany neck and ebony fretboard provide durability and smooth playability.

Does the Sigma SDR-28 come with any built-in electronics?

No, the Sigma SDR-28 does not have any built-in electronics or pickups, making it a purely acoustic guitar designed for traditional playing and sound projection.

How many frets does the Sigma SDR-28 have?

The Sigma SDR-28 comes with 20 frets, allowing for a wide range of notes and chords, suitable for both rhythm and lead playing.

Is the Sigma SDR-28 suitable for fingerstyle playing?

Yes, the Sigma SDR-28's dreadnought body and tonewoods offer a balanced sound that can accommodate fingerstyle playing, providing clarity and resonance across the strings.

Owner Insights

We analyzed real musician discussions from forums and Reddit to find what players love, question, and tweak about Sigma Standard Series SDR-28.

Comparisons

  • The Sigma SDR-28 C is perceived by some owners to have a louder volume than a Martin D-18, though the latter may have a superior tone.

  • Some owners find the Sigma SDR-28 to have a wider tonal range and more punchy tone compared to Martin guitars, which they describe as slightly muffled.

Mods and upgrades

  • Owners have successfully added brass bridge pins and a Tusq nut to improve sound quality, suggesting these as viable upgrades.

User experience

  • An owner mentioned that their Sigma SDR-28 C needed only one setup in 25 years, indicating long-term reliability.

Build quality

  • It's noted that the "C" designation may indicate a cosmetic blemish, which can significantly reduce the instrument's original price.
